Does anyone know where I can buy a pack of the most common SMT
resistor values? Something on the order of 10 each of common values,
2-300 parts total would be good.

Ten times what you want and you don't say where in the world you are,
but Rapid Electronics here in the UK do a pack with 100 each of 39
different 1206 resistors. £23.50 + VAT.
A similar pack for caps would be handy too.

They also do a pack of 100 each of 18 different 0805 ceramic chip
capacitors. £43.50 + VAT.

http://www.rapidelectronics.co.uk/

RS (http://rswww.com) here also do kits, with 50 each of various
values, but they appear to be wildly expensive. 50 is RS's minimum
order on SMT resistors, 100 is Rapid's minimum. I don't know how much
luck you'll have finding someone willing to count out 10 each of the
tiny little buggers for you :)
